Louis Armstrong went from privation and speakeasies to Broadway and Hollywood. In the Thirties, he became an international celebrity. In the Fifties, he toured Africa and had his life story documented on LP and filmed for TV. He was the first US entertainer to become a world statesman.

This indispensable collection ranges from Armstrong's sideman sessions in the Twenties to some of his greatest Thirties and Forties big band tracks, to his pop hits of the Sixties.

Covering over 50 years of Louis Armstrong's career, this three-CD set from the Verve archives starts in the juke joints and speakeasies of the '20s and ends up documenting his pop hits of the '60s. Chronicling the achievements of a prolific and diverse performer of Anderson's caliber is difficult, but this release gives a strong, broad overview of one of the great pioneers of jazz. The Ultimate Collection features jazz greats such as Coleman Hawkins, "Fatha" Earl Hines, and Jack Teagarden, as well as vocal performances by Billie Holiday, Bing Crosby, the Mills Brothers, Ella Fitzgerald, and many others. ~ Zac Johnson, All Music Guide
